Notes Dr. This study by Yılmaz Ari examines the Alevi culture and belief in Adıyaman by focusing on the perspectives of the dedes and the disciples. The author explores the role and importance of dedes as religious authorities and how they contributed to Alevi culture. The study acknowledges that Alevi culture still exists in the six hearths in Adıyaman and that dedes fulfill important roles such as conducting ceremonies and mediating conflicts, but the institution of dedelik has been affected by secularization, leading to changes in religious and social values. The study also highlights the weakening of the relationship between grandfather and suitor due to urbanization and its impact on their interactions and participation in religious rituals. The author suggests that younger generations are moving away from their grandfathers due to modernization and a more educated mentality. However, the study also emphasizes that despite the difficulties, dedes continue their importance and functions in preserving Alevi culture. In conclusion, this study offers an illuminating analysis about Alevism and the institution of dedelik and provides valuable perspectives for further research.
